The Quran is the holy book of Islam, believed by Muslims to be the word of God as revealed to the Prophet Muhammad. It serves as a guide for Muslims in all aspects of life, providing teachings on faith, morality, and conduct. The Quran shapes the beliefs and practices of Muslims by outlining the principles of Islam, including the Five Pillars, moral guidelines, and laws for personal and societal behavior. Muslims look to the Quran for spiritual guidance, moral direction, and inspiration in their daily lives.

Muslims believe in the concept of an afterlife rather than a past life. According to Islamic teachings, individuals are accountable for their actions in this life and will face judgment after death. Those who have lived righteously will be rewarded with paradise, while those who have sinned without repentance may face punishment. This belief emphasizes the importance of living a moral and faithful life in the present.

The Quran is believed to be the literal word of God revealed to Prophet Muhammad. It serves as the ultimate source of guidance and moral teachings for Muslims, providing instructions on how to live a pious and righteous life. Due to its divine origin, the Quran holds immense spiritual significance and authority in the lives of Muslims.
